Battery Life
The Blackview BV8200 boasts an impressive 118:45h endurance rating and a remarkable 800 charge cycles, indicating a focus on long-term battery health. The Ulefone Power Armor 19T, while lacking a specific endurance rating, compensates with significantly faster charging: 66W wired, capable of reaching 52% charge in just 30 minutes. It also adds 15W wireless charging and 5W reverse wireless charging, features absent on the BV8200. The BV8200’s 45W wired charging is adequate, but the 19T’s speed is a clear convenience advantage. The 800 charge cycle rating of the BV8200 suggests a longer lifespan for the battery itself, even with frequent use.
